Performed in duet by Erin Mallon and JF Harding! A spicy and hilarious forbidden small town rom com from #1 New York Times bestselling author Lauren Blakely!

He ghosted me once, now he’s supposed to protect me?

I don’t need a bodyguard—I run a small-town lavender farm, for bee’s sake. But when my identical twin sister lands the movie role of a lifetime that’s being shot in my hometown I get one anyway. And guess which broody, tattooed protector the studio sends to keep the paparazzi off my porch?

Last month’s almost one-night stand. The guy with the wicked mouth and heated eyes who slipped out before the fun even started. But turns out the sexy jerk is excellent at rescuing me from sneaky photographers at the market. Then the coffee shop. I’m trying hard to stay mad after the third time my new bodyguard saves me.

To top it all off, he’s staying in the cottage at my farm. With me. And there’s only one bed.

Maybe if we finally give in and finish what we started, it’ll relieve the tension? But one night quickly turns into another. Then into late-night secrets and soft confessions we shouldn’t say out loud. Especially since he’s leaving and I’m staying, and there’s no way we can be more than a summer romance that ends far too soon.

I don’t think you can go wrong if you are looking for a quick, fun, and easy read/listen that does not require too much brain power and leaves you with a feeling of contentment. Ms. Blakely is definitely consistent.

We are taken back to the small town of Darling Springs in this romance between FMC Ripley - the owner of a Lavender Farm (yep, did not know that was a thing) and MMC Banks - the man who is assigned as her bodyguard.

See, Ripley is a twin and her twin sister Haven is an up and coming actress who is going to be filming her next movie in - you guessed it - Darling Springs. Since Ripley and Haven look exactly alike and the film is garnering quite a bit of attention, it is deemed important that Ripley have a close body protector too.

Unfortunately, the two MC’s met right before all of this was known and had an unfortunate encounter. That is the premise going forward as we watch Ripley and Banks navigate their circumstances.

As usual, I alternated between listening and reading and really enjoyed the audio version. It was narrated by Erin Mallon and J.F. Harding so I knew that they would do a wonderful job and I was not disappointed.
